"Old Monster, next, I'm going to show you my greatest gain. Have a good look." As he spoke, Tianlin's second Soul Ring lit up. "Second Soul Skill, Icefire God Sealing!"

"Oh, your second Soul Ring is already a thousand-year one? You really are worthy of being called a Little Monster!" Though Dugu Bo was somewhat surprised, he remained unmoved. After all, what could an attack from a mere Soul Grandmaster possibly do to him?

But in the next instant, as Tianlin slashed out with his longsword, Dugu Bo sensed an intense threat from the sword qi.

Instinct drove him to defend himself at once. "Fifth Soul Skill, Serpent Python Heavenly Shield!"

The Jade Scale Serpent Emperor curled into a ball and transformed into a shield. This was Dugu Bo's only defensive Soul Skill. The fact that he used it against Tianlin's attack showed how seriously he regarded him.

Two streams of sword qi, one frigid and one scorching, struck the shield. With Tianlin's current two-ring strength, he naturally could not break Dugu Bo's fifth Soul Skill. However, Dugu Bo discovered that the corrosive power of the ice and fire attributes on his shield did not fade away along with the sword qi. If he withdrew the Heavenly Shield now, he feared he would still be injured by the power of ice and fire.

That attack's power was already comparable to a Soul Ancestor's, but that isn't the main point. What is this Attribute Power? It actually made even me, a Titled Douluo, feel threatened and forced me to use a Soul Skill to defend myself. Dugu Bo thought of a possibility, then asked in alarm, "Little Monster, has your ice and fire power evolved into Ultimate Ice and Ultimate Fire?"

Only ultimate attributes could unleash such terrifying power.

Tianlin readily admitted it. "That's right. From now on, no fire-attribute or ice-attribute Soul Master can stand against me."

This Little Monster is truly terrifying. Soul Masters with ultimate attributes are far stronger in battle than other Soul Masters of the same rank. It is already unimaginably difficult for an ordinary person to possess even one ultimate attribute, yet he can wield Ultimate Fire and Ultimate Ice—two completely opposite, even conflicting attributes—as easily as his own limbs. By the day he receives his title, he may become invincible across the world, perhaps even powerful enough to reshape the continent's balance. Dugu Bo thought.

"Old Monster, don't lose focus. My attack isn't over yet. Golden Flame Soul Burn!" Tianlin activated his External Soul Bone. Even the soul-fire attribute within it had advanced into Ultimate Fire, catching Dugu Bo completely off guard.

His Serpent Python Heavenly Shield could only defend against physical attacks. It was utterly useless against soul attacks.

"Ugh!" Dugu Bo clutched his head and staggered back repeatedly. Just moments ago, his soul had seemed to be thrown into a blazing inferno, suffering unbearable torment. Fortunately, he was a Titled Douluo, and his soul power far surpassed Tianlin's. He only felt pain for a moment before quickly recovering.

"Little Monster, y-your eyes... could they be an External Soul Bone?"

"That's right, Old Monster. Thanks to those two immortal herbs strengthening my body, I finally fused completely with this External Soul Bone. And the soul fire in my External Soul Bone is also an ultimate attribute. So, what do you think? That soul attack just now was pretty good, wasn't it?" Tianlin said with a smile.

Dugu Bo no longer knew what to say. Tianlin had given him too many surprises: Twin Martial Souls, ultimate attributes, an External Soul Bone—things that were unattainable dreams on the Soul Master's Dream Ranking had all appeared in a single person. Dugu Bo could only sigh at how exceptionally blessed Tianlin was compared with everyone else.

"It was indeed good. But Little Monster, don't get complacent. Ultimate attributes are a double-edged sword. Though their power is boundless, they will slow your cultivation speed. An ultimate martial soul cultivates at an ordinary rate before level thirty, at a snail's pace between levels thirty and seventy, and only begins advancing rapidly after level seventy. Therefore, your greatest hurdle will be level seventy. Once you break through that barrier, becoming a Titled Douluo will be as easy as taking something from your pocket," Dugu Bo reminded him.

Tianlin was about to reach level thirty, which meant he would soon enter the slowest period of his cultivation. That period would be his greatest test.

"Old Monster, you don't need to worry about that. Though this ultimate attribute means I'll lose my cultivation speed that far surpasses ordinary people, I won't be slower than others. Because I have this—the Holy Spirit Pearl. Holy Breath Barrier, activate." Tianlin opened his Holy Breath Barrier once more and said, "Old Monster, try meditating within my barrier."

"What a bunch of nonsense." Though Dugu Bo did not understand what he meant, he still sat down as instructed. The moment he began meditating, he was startled. His meditation speed was actually much faster than before. "Little Monster, your Second Spirit's innate barrier can actually enhance cultivation speed!"

"That's right. With this, I can completely make up for the shortcomings of an ultimate martial soul. Even if my cultivation speed won't be as terrifying as before, after level thirty, it should still be no worse than that of an ordinary Soul Master with Innate Full Soul Power!" Tianlin walked up to Dugu Bo. "Well, Old Monster, my abilities are pretty impressive, aren't they? Would you like to join my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Sect? With my help, I can at least guarantee that you'll become a Super Douluo above level ninety-five."

Tianlin had revealed so many secrets to Dugu Bo. Aside from knowing from the original story that once he earned Dugu Bo's recognition, he could trust him completely, another reason was that he wanted to recruit him.

Dugu Bo might not be strong in single combat, but in large-scale battles, his abilities were nothing short of a nightmare for low-level Soul Masters. With him, no tactic based on sheer numbers would ever have any effect on the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Sect again.

To be honest, Dugu Bo was tempted. First, Tianlin had been sincere enough to trust him, revealing secrets such as his Twin Martial Souls without holding anything back. Second, there was the temptation of reaching above level ninety-five. He knew he was already old and that his potential had basically reached its limit. If he did not cure his poison, he might not even have many years left to live. Now that he had hope of reaching a higher realm, how could he remain unmoved?

Moreover, if Tianlin cured his deadly poison, it would be a life-saving grace to him. Dugu Bo might repay every grievance, but he also repaid every kindness.

"Little Monster, let me think it over," Dugu Bo finally said after a moment of silence.

He longed for greater strength, but he also longed for freedom and did not wish to be bound by a sect.

Tianlin knew that his resolve had already softened, so it would not do to pressure him too hard. He immediately nodded. "All right, Old Monster. I'll be staying here for half a year anyway, so you have plenty of time to think. But remember, the gates of my Seven Treasure Glazed Tile Sect will always be open to you. That is the promise of this sect's future Sect Protecting Douluo."

"Thank you." Dugu Bo revealed a faint smile. He had said those two words only a handful of times in his life, but today, he sincerely wished to express his gratitude to Tianlin.
